SELEUKID KINGS OF SYRIA. Antiochos I Soter, 281-261 BC. Tetradrachm (Silver, 29 mm, 16.90 g, 2 h), Seleukia on the Tigris. Diademed head of Antiochos I to right. Rev. 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Σ ΑΝΤΙΟXΟΥ Apollo seated left on omphalos, holding arrow in his right hand and resting his right on his bow; to left and right, monogram. ESM 155, type 2. SC 379.3c. A toned coin with an attractive portrait. Remains of corrosion damage on the reverse , otherwise, good very fine.

From the collection of W. F. Stoecklin, Amriswil, Switzerland, acquired prior to 1975.
